Terrific cyclone devastates Regina leaving many dead

A cyclone struck Regina Saskatchewan last evening killing at least forty one and injuring hundreds. Debris blocks streets as doctors and nurses rush to aid the wounded. The new parliament building is badly shaken, several churches and the Y M C A are wrecked, and 600 families are left homeless as relief begins.

Williston: A City of Opportunity Rising in North Dakota

The Seven States Sun touts Williston as the coming trade center for western North Dakota and eastern Montana. It highlights strategic location near the Missouri River, rich lignite coal fields, irrigation projects and growing population from 1,200 to about 5,000 in five years. It notes strong banking, a thriving mill and diverse irrigated crops from wheat to vegetables, with documented gains in commerce and industry.

Hanna Thanks Many Friends for Governor Nomination

L. B. Hanna expresses sincere appreciation to the Republican voters for nominating him for governor. He pledges to unite the party, govern in a businesslike manner, and earn the respect and confidence of all the people if elected in November. He cannot thank each supporter in person but extends gratitude to all.

Wilson Nominated by Democrats for President

Baltimore dispatch reports Wilson leading as a progressive candidate amid a lengthy balloting process. After forty six ballots across many states including Maryland Michigan North Carolina and Wisconsin the nomination fight continues with Underwood and other contenders still in play.

Arthur Johnson Heads to the Giants in Major League Bid

Madison Wis and Williston fans recall Arthur Johnson a slim young pitcher from Madison who may be sold to the New York Giants for a liberal price. Muggsy McGraw has closed negotiations with Madison officials as Johnson’s star rises amid interest from St Cloud and Oshkosh.

Runaway Horses Warn Williston Residents

In a recent week two runaways caused damage though no injuries. One wagon was badly smashed and another horse broke its neck after a fall. Officials urge residents to tie horses on Main Street to prevent further incidents and protect others.
